Building on the bedrock of classic search and ranking systems based on established algorithms like BM25, the advent of vector search has opened doors to developing hybrid search systems that deliver highly relevant results. Though ranking algorithms in Lucene-based products are powerful, they sometimes come up short, leading to low recall with zero results or poor relevancy.

In this session, we’ll explore the use of unstructured data such as images and text for fuzzy searching and enhanced search relevancy. We’ll discuss best practices of using pre/post metadata filtering as well as defining hybrid ranking that combines both BM25 scores with vector-based algorithms such as HNSW.

Additionally, we will delve into the complexity of moving from research to production, achieving real-time at scale while managing the tradeoff between performance and accuracy.
